¿Cuánto cuesta alquilar un apartamento en 77029?
| Dormitorios | Precio Promedio | Más barato | Más caro |
|---|---|---|---|
| Apartamentos 1 Dormitorios en 77029 | $852 | $530 | $1,099 |
| Apartamentos 2 Dormitorios en 77029 | $1,031 | $840 | $1,500 |
| Apartamentos 3 Dormitorios en 77029 | $1,379 | $1,070 | $1,654 |
| Apartamentos 4 Dormitorios en 77029 | $1,519 | $1,399 | $1,761 |
